Position: Home page » Blockchain » Blockchain technology was first used in Geek

Blockchain technology was first used in Geek

Publish: 2021-05-20 00:28:14
1.

From the perspective of technology and architecture, I will tell you my understanding of blockchain in common language

what is blockchain? In a word, blockchain is a storage system. To be more specific, blockchain is a distributed storage system without an administrator and each node has all the data

What are the common storage systems like

first, how to ensure high availability

the common storage system usually uses "rendancy" to solve the problem of high availability. As shown in the figure above, if the data can be copied into several copies and rendant to multiple places, high availability can be guaranteed. The data in one place is hung, and there is data in other places. For example, the master-slave cluster of MySQL is the same principle, and the raid of disk is also the same principle

two points need to be emphasized in this place are: data rendancy often leads to consistency problems

1. For example, in the master-slave cluster of MySQL, there is actually a delay in reading and writing, which means there is a inconsistency in reading and writing in a short period of time. This is a side effect of data rendancy

The second point is that data rendancy often reces the efficiency of writing, because data synchronization also consumes resources. If you add two slave libraries, the write efficiency will be affected. The common storage system is to use rendancy to ensure the high availability of data

so the second question, ordinary storage system, can write more

the answer is yes, for example, take this graph as an example:

in fact, MySQL can do a master-slave synchronization of al masters, master-slave synchronization of al masters, two nodes can be written at the same time. If you want to do a multi room multi live data center, in fact, multi room multi live data synchronization. What we should emphasize here is that multi-point writing often leads to the consistency problem of writing conflicts. Take MySQL as an example, suppose that the attribute of a table is self incrementing ID, then the data in the database is 1234 now. If one of the nodes writes and inserts a piece of data, it may become 5, and then these 5 pieces of data are synchronized to another master node, Before synchronization, if another write node inserts a piece of data, a piece of data with self incrementing ID of 5 will be generated. Then, after the generation, synchronize to another node, and the synchronized data will conflict with the two local 5's after it arrives, which will lead to synchronization failure and write consistency conflict. This problem will occur in the case of multi-point writing

how to ensure consistency in multi-point writing

the reform "Swan class" gives you more technical work

2. Traditional transactions on the Internet need to rely on trusted third-party institutions to process electronic payment information, and both parties trust the third-party institutions However, the third-party intervention also has many disadvantages:< Br > - high transaction cost (a certain handling charge)< Br > - Privacy exposure (the third party needs to provide the information of both parties in order to verify the information)< Br > -... < br > imagine that if the third-party organization is removed and the two parties trade directly, how can the transaction take effect? The emergence of blockchain technology is to solve this problem. Blockchain is based on the principle of cryptography rather than trust mechanism, which makes the two parties reach an agreement to trade directly and publish it to all witnesses.
3.

From the perspective of technology and architecture, I will tell you my understanding of blockchain in common language

what is blockchain? In a word, blockchain is a storage system. To be more specific, blockchain is a distributed storage system without an administrator and each node has all the data

What are the common storage systems like

as shown in the figure above, the bottom is data, and the top can write data. A space to store data, a software to manage data, provide an interface to write data, this is the storage system. For example, MySQL is the most common storage system

What are the problems of ordinary storage system? There are at least two common problems

the first is the problem of non high availability. There is a dangerous place for data. In technical terms, data is not highly available

The second problem is that there is only one write point. In technical terms, it is a single point of control

How do ordinary storage systems usually solve these two problems

in fact, MySQL can do a master-slave synchronization of al master, master-slave synchronization of al master, two nodes can be written at the same time. If you want to do a multi room multi live data center, in fact, multi room multi live data synchronization. What we should emphasize here is that multi-point writing often leads to the consistency problem of writing conflicts. Take MySQL as an example, suppose that the attribute of a table is self incrementing ID, then the data in the database is 1234 now. If one of the nodes writes and inserts a piece of data, it may become 5, and then these 5 pieces of data are synchronized to another master node, Before synchronization, if another write node inserts a piece of data, a piece of data with self incrementing ID of 5 will be generated. Then, after the generation, synchronize to another node, and the synchronized data will conflict with the two local 5's after it arrives, which will lead to synchronization failure and write consistency conflict. This problem will occur in the case of multi-point writing

how to ensure consistency in multi-point writing

the reform "Swan class" gives you more technical work

4. In March 2016, Zhong Xiao, chairman and CEO of Rongze technology, was invited to visit the UK together with Professor Cai Weide, a well-known blockchain expert and head of Beihang's "digital society and blockchain" laboratory, to participate in the big data summit held by IEEE, the world's top academic organization, in Oxford - blockchain forum. Rongze technology has become the first batch of Chinese high-tech enterprises to participate in global blockchain discussions.
5. At present, Internet breeding software includes all people raising cattle, Lenong's home, Aishang raising pig, chicken housekeeper, ugly ckling farm, etc. all people raising cattle, falling in love with raising pig and chicken housekeeper are income oriented apps with little user interaction. They are investment income oriented apps. Ugly ckling farm is an app developed by Shenzhen ugly ckling Innovation Technology Co., Ltd., focusing on user breeding experience, Real time online breeding and offline breeding can be synchronized. Those who have children at home and need to raise their own cks to supplement their families can raise their own cks and eat by themselves through this platform, which is visible in real time, green and pollution-free, and recommended by the wall.
6. You can use the battery manager of Tencent mobile phone manager to maintain and manage the battery
Tencent battery manager will intelligently rece the CPU frequency and keep the minimum power consumption
in normal use, Tencent battery manager will maintain a stable CPU frequency,
keep the best power saving state without affecting the experience; When playing games,
battery manager will give full play to the powerful performance of CPU and improve the fun of playing games.
7. All day trading... The website has no rest
Hot content
Inn digger Publish: 2021-05-29 20:04:36 Views: 341
Purchase of virtual currency in trust contract dispute Publish: 2021-05-29 20:04:33 Views: 942
Blockchain trust machine Publish: 2021-05-29 20:04:26 Views: 720
Brief introduction of ant mine Publish: 2021-05-29 20:04:25 Views: 848
Will digital currency open in November Publish: 2021-05-29 19:56:16 Views: 861
Global digital currency asset exchange Publish: 2021-05-29 19:54:29 Views: 603
Mining chip machine S11 Publish: 2021-05-29 19:54:26 Views: 945
Ethereum algorithm Sha3 Publish: 2021-05-29 19:52:40 Views: 643
Talking about blockchain is not reliable Publish: 2021-05-29 19:52:26 Views: 754
Mining machine node query Publish: 2021-05-29 19:36:37 Views: 750